

XRP, Aptos, and Chainlink Top the List of Trending Tokens as Altcoins Rebound with New Developments
As altcoins make a strong rebound, familiar names are topping the list of trending tokens with exciting new developments driving market interest.
Top trending tokens as altcoins rebound
Familiar names top the popular coin charts, and exciting new developments are driving market interest.
XRP ($XRP) dominates the top spot, with traders relishing Bitwise’s ETP filing and renewed discussions on the SEC’s appeal of a ruling that classified XRP as a non-security. The legal dispute has reignited debate over Ripple’s operations and what the outcome could mean for XRP holders.
The uncertainty surrounding the case has kept XRP in the spotlight, with many speculating on the long-term impact it may have on the future of the token.
Second place goes to Aptos ($APT), driven by Aptos Labs’ acquisition of HashPalette Inc., a move aimed at solidifying its position in the Japanese blockchain market. This strategic expansion demonstrates Aptos’ growing ambitions and its aim to expand into the Asian market. Additionally, Franklin Templeton’s OnChain U.S. Government Monetary Fund launched on the Aptos blockchain, highlighting growing institutional interest and, in turn, increasing confidence in the platform’s future.
Chainlink ($LINK) rounded out the top three, driven by its partnership with SWIFT on blockchain technology and interoperability efforts. Chainlink’s Cross-Chain Interoperability Protocol (CCIP) has been a key player in connecting various blockchain networks, allowing financial institutions to streamline operations.
CCIP’s successful trials with SWIFT have fueled enthusiasm as they demonstrate Chainlink’s real potential to transform the financial industry with blockchain solutions.

Brazil was the first to approve the world's first XRP spot ETF, and XRP prices rose! According to Brazilian media PortaldoBitcoin, the Ripple (XRP) spot ETF application submitted by digital asset management company Hashdex in Brazil has been approved by the Brazilian Securities Commission (CVM), becoming the world's first approved XRP spot ETF. Although the ETF's listing date on the Brazil Stock Exchange (B3) has not been announced yet, the news has triggered positive reactions from the market. Silvio Pegado, managing director of Ripple Las America, said the practical application value of XRP and growing institutional demand drive this result, and Brazil's move demonstrates its innovators in the cryptocurrency market and financial sectors.

The crypto market fell sharply under the impact of the US imposing tariffs! Coinglass data shows that in the past 24 hours, the amount of liquidated in the cryptocurrency market exceeded US$2 billion, of which the long orders were liquidated in US$1.81 billion, and the short orders were liquidated in more than US$288 million, with more than 710,000 affected users. Bitcoin's continued decline is the main cause. Ethereum fell below $2,100 and other mainstream cryptocurrencies performed weaker. Ethereum price fell to $2,086 at one point, hitting a new low since August last year. Although it has rebounded above $2,400, the 24-hour decline is still more than 20%.
